Coup d’etat in Guinea-Bissau Regrettable – AU, ECOWAS and West African Elders Express Deep Concern

 

Source: Africa Publicity

The heads of the African Union Election Observation Mission (AUEOM), the ECOWAS Election Observation Mission (EOM) and the West African Elders Forum have described the coup d’etat in Guinea-Bissau as “regrettable”, expressing “deep concern” over the development and calling for an urgent return to democratic rule.

In a joint statement released on Wednesday, November 26, 2025 following the announcement by the soldiers that they have taken “total control” of Guinea-Bissau, the AUEOM, EOM and the West African Elders Forum deplored what they termed as the “blatant attempt to disrupt the democratic process and the gains that have been achieved thus far.”

The statement added that “We request the African Union and the ECOWAS to take the necessary steps to restore constitutional order.”

According to the statement, “We express concern of the arrests of top officials including those that are in charge of the electoral process. In this regard, we urge the armed forces to immediately release the detained officials to allow the country’s electoral process to proceed to its conclusion.”
